The compatibilitytrackers t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about compatibility tracking for Windows systems, particularly in the context of migrating from Windows 10 to newer platforms like Arm-powered Copilot+ PCs. Topics include monitoring software and hardware compatibility during upgrades, ensuring legacy applications work on new architectures, and using tools to track compatibility status across devices. The tag is relevant for users and IT professionals planning transitions to Windows 11 or Arm-based devices, focusing on practical strategies to avoid compatibility issues.
